Tried update, it checks files downloads, the says cannot install, previously terminated by user....no I didnt!
Perhaps you didn't respond to the Windows UAC prompt at the end of the download, which is required to apply the update. If you don't respond to it within a certain period, it cancels itself and DCS cannot apply the update.

As you noticed, the solution is to run DCS update again. It uses the files that were previously downloaded so you don't waste time there.

You first need to find where you installed DCS World, below is the path to my installation which is NOT the default location. I would assume it would be Program Files\DCS World\etc etc...... What you need to find is the DCS_updater.exe in the bin directory. Once there right click and create a shortcut. Then right-click on the shortcut you have created and select properties. In the target field you will want to type repair so that it appears as below. Then execute that shortcut. As you can see mine is on my I: drive but yours will most likely reside on your c: drive in program files.

 

 

 

 

"I:\DCS World\DCS World\bin\DCS_updater.exe" repair

Voodoo, if you have problem with a .bin (or any other type) file you downloaded, the first thing to do is to check if the downloaded file is OK.

 

Two ways to do that:

- Assume the downloaded file is not OK, drop it, and re-download (you still won't be sure the newly downloaded file is OK).

- Don't assume anything, but do check the file:

--- First thing is to check the size of the file. If its size does not match the published size, your download went wront, re-try a new download.

--- If the file size appears correct, but you still got a problem using it, you have a way to be pretty sure : the MD5 sum check. ED published the MD5 signatures of the files to download on the download page (here). Use a MD5 tool (software) to check the MD5 sum of the file you downloaded. If it does not match with the one published by ED, then you're sure your download went wrong somewhere. Re-download the file until you got a matching MD5 (= a correct file).
